I think making reeds is an integral part of oboe playing. There are different opinions on how important the reed is, as opposed to how important everything else is (instrument, person, setup), but it is never too early to start developing knife technique, a skill that takes years to develop.

The reality is its going to take years for you to become self sufficient at reedmaking, probably 4-5 years if you play as an amateur, and even longer if you're just starting to play oboe, and therefore since you don't know what your physical setup should be, you don't know what a good reed should feel like to accomodate your physical setup. As long as you're under guidance of a teacher, I think it can't hurt to start early, as long as you give yourself time and patience without expecting immediate results.
